Greens Pie

This greens pie is a quick and easy use it up recipe that turns leftover veggies into a golden, cheesy dinner the whole family will love. If you’ve got odds and ends wilting in the crisper, you can reduce your food waste by repurposing them in this recipe. Simply sauté with garlic and onion before folding into puff pastry to create a comforting meal. It’s ideal for a quick dinner and works perfectly as leftovers for lunch the next day! Ready in under 40 minutes and incredibly adaptable, this greens pie proves that leftovers can become the star of the table.

Need

1 onion, sliced
2 garlic cloves, sliced
Greens (we used spinach, zucchini, broccoli and silverbeet)
1 sheet of frozen pastry
Cheese, grated (we used cheddar)
1 tbsp olive oil
Salt and pepper to season

How

  1. Sauté onion over medium heat until fragrant.
  2. Add sliced garlic and the thinly sliced stems of any greens.
  3. Once softened, add any other vegetables and cook until soft.
  4. Season with salt and pepper.
  5. Cool veggie mix, then pile it in the middle of a puff pastry sheet, fold the edges in and top with grated cheese.
  6. Bake at 190c for 30-35 minutes, until golden. Enjoy!
